**Mgmt Meeting Minutes — Retiring the Brightline Range**

Quick recap for sales leads at Fenholt Supplies: we agreed to retire the Brightline fixture range by year-end. Remaining stock moves to clearance pricing next month, and accounts on standing orders get migrated to the Lumetta range. Trade-in incentives were approved in principle. The confidential note on next steps sits just below.

board note of bajof-bajeg: The pricing group signed off on a budget of $13.4 million for Project Sildor. The renewal with Lamixek Holdings closes at $48.9 million a year, 49 percent above the last contract.

Step 4 — Sharding the profile store. Once Burrowbase is in maintenance mode, run the shard-split tool against the user-profile keyspace. It'll carve profiles into 16 shards by account hash. Don't panic if shard 0 lags; it always does. When the split report shows all green, promote the new topology with the deploy CLI. The CLI signs the topology manifest before pushing, so have the deploy key ready — here it is:

release key, fajef-kajeg: bky19_LdLu6Ne6FLi8he2c24d

Quick download on the Orvetta retail pilot before I roll off. We're live in twelve Bramblewick stores with the ShelfSense kiosks; eight more come online next month. Store staff feedback is good, sell-through data is noisy but trending up. Watch the install backlog — the fit-out crew keeps slipping dates. Key contacts are Priya on our side and the Bramblewick category team. Budget is fine through Q3. The confidential expansion terms and pricing discussion are appended just below.

board note of kageg-bahof: The renewal with Holwynax Holdings closes at $2 million a year, 5 percent below the last contract. Project Ulaath slips by two quarters because of the supplier delay.

Runbook: TideLine Widget

So the tide-table widget (TideLine) occasionally shows stale predictions when the Moorgate feed hiccups. First check: is the cache older than six hours? If yes, bounce the refresher job — it's safe to run mid-cycle. If the feed itself is down, TideLine falls back to the harmonic model, which is fine for a day or so, so don't page anyone at 3am. When bouncing the refresher, make sure it starts with the settings below.

config for kajog-tadug:
[casax]
port = 11211
region = west-3
host = casax.nelvroworks.internal
timeout_ms = 5000
retries = 7